Here are 5 facts about Quebec City

1. It was founded by Samuel de Champlain on July 3rd 1608 and it was part of New France.
2. It is the capital city of Quebec.
3. The language spoken there is French.
4. It's population as of 2017 is 542,298
5. The word "Québec" comes from Kébec, a name the Algonquin people originally gave which means "where the river narrows."

Here are 5 facts about the United States

1. Washington D.C. is its capital and the only city that's not in a state.
2. It gained independence on July 4th 1776. It only had 13 states. They were New Hampshire, Massachussetts, Rhode Island, Connecticut, New York,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, Delaware, Maryland, Virgina, North Carolina, South Carolina and Georgia. 
3. Today there are 50 states. 
4. The flag has 50 stars, representing each state. Every time a new state joined, the flag was redesigned to add another star. The 13 stripes represent the 13 colonies.
5. The national anthem is The Star Spangled Banner which became official in 1931.
